Output 82e675a325e639e9253e0968cf6daf623467b10bf158979fcaf4ade6ef459289:0

value
15399500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b65d49e926700216a9f1158e0cd415e45aa49a OP_EQUAL
address
MBLZhRr3efa5L5HhVAef76mtXdxiv29Jrk
transaction
82e675a325e639e9253e0968cf6daf623467b10bf158979fcaf4ade6ef459289
spent
true